Les pierres de tes palais se disjoignent 
(The stones of your palace are falling apart)_ phrase from Gustave Flaubert's book "Memoires d'un fou"
​
2020

Inspired by baroque and renaissance palaces, in this series I wanted my characters to reside in beautiful, extravagant mansions, mostly inspired by existing famous lamdmarks of neoclassical architecture, such as the Opera Garnier in Paris, the Caserta Palace in Italy, the Versailles, the Château de Fontainebleau. The  female characters are lost in their own sphere of existence , each on its(her) own dream, detached from the surroundings , unable to connenct with each other or with reality.  As I always find deep inpiration from litterature, I wanted my paintings to have the sensation of a dream, a quite absurd one, as well as to recreate the atmosphere and the feeling of classic french litterature of 19th century. 
Pur comme un parfum_water oils on canvas, 125 x115 cm, 2020
Ses flots d'harmonie_water oils on canvas, 125x115 cm, 2020
Puissance magique_water oils on canvas, 140x170 cm, 2020
Le sublime_water oils and oil pastels on canvas, 135x 105 cm, 2020
